我有一个要求,我必须在Firebase中批量创建用户。我正在考虑使用Admin SDK中提供的 importUsers 方法,因为Web SDK的限制为100 acc / IP /小时。问题是, importUsers 不会进行重复检查。如果我两次添加相同的电子邮件,则会在Auth表中使用相同的电子邮件发送2个帐户。假设我有100个JSON格式的用户数组,那么在调用 importUsers 之前进行循环并调用 getUserByEmail 来检查每个用户电子邮件是否存在是否会非常慢?或者有任何正确的方法来实现这一目标吗?
请注意,我在云端功能中运行Admin SDK。
谢谢!